Web the half double crochet back loop stitch creates a doubled lattice pattern that is similar to the half double crochet (hdc) but it is only worked through the back loop of the stitch, so it creates a reversible ridged fabric. Web The Steps Of The Half Double Crochet Is To Yarn Over, Insert The Hook Into The Stitch Or Space Indicated On The Pattern Instructions, Pull Up A Loop, Yarn Over And Pull Through All 3 Loops On The Crochet Hook.
